Appointment of a Common Adjudicating Authority under the Customs Act to consolidate adjudication of linked show cause proceedings. The Central Board of Excise and Customs, exercising powers under section 4(1) and section 5(1) of the Customs Act, appoints the Joint Commissioner or Additional Commissioner of Customs at CFS, ICD, G.T. Road, Sahnewal, Ludhiana to perform the functions and discharge the duties of three specified Joint Commissioners of Customs for adjudication of the DRI show cause notice concerning M/s A & N Impex.
